Mario Morino

From EverybodyWiki Bios & Wiki


Mario Morino is a Full professor at the University of Turin, Italy in the department of Surgery.[1][2][3]

Education

Mario Morino went to the University of Turin and graduated in 1982 with a degree in Medicine and Surgery. He specialized in General Surgery at the University of Turin in 1987.[citation needed]

Research and career

Mario Morino’s principal research areas include laparoscopic colorectal surgery and oncology, laparoscopic cholecystectomy, obesity surgery, laparoscopic surgery for reflux, and laparoscopic surgery for the adrenal glands.[4][5] Prof. Mario Morino has conducted more than 9000 laparoscopic procedures and around 5000 open procedures.[6] His primary clinical interests include minimally invasive colorectal cancer treatment, bariatric surgery, and functional upper GI surgery.[7][8]

In 2021, he received the Lifetime Achievement Award from the World Congress of Endoscopic Surgery for his work on minimally invasive surgical procedures.[9][10]

Morino is presently working as Chief of Oncologic surgery at the University of Turin.
